From nobody Fri Sep 15 15:25:42 2023 X-Original-To: standards@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4RnJ13192Yz4sqvK for ; Fri, 15 Sep 2023 15:25:43 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4RnJ1308Hjz4SGq for ; Fri, 15 Sep 2023 15:25:43 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1694791543; a=rsa-sha256; cv=none; b=n0WMmIYhEK8hBLcd8QjIgNurHqP/cAFiOHT+Uyg8gIhTytsG2br60DcwQ2H1ViTlDalQvG x3uFpeA2OeNqUh3SY13QHeISGn5Kc/C+LbIjoTzYBXko4qlPVNzsw7emB22nMHe+U5zum+ iI8N2062FqYXPhc06dE42uvEUpoNaNSp4Aq5EfaLoxKKfGhPcodlZww81aZlUvTVGZgs7O 9Duw0vjp+cCmbJ3hUwl4M1k92omt0vHxqxLtmtCrw1AZBCs+04tg2428rhGUY4j0iK4y7N Hkb7KODomH5ZRxzDf72WriB0xaBhXJzcQeMlvXqQbTdpJT02wGDJdk4mJb0Epw==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1694791543;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=bV+PKpaKPo8jogxCXyXSyf3MchLs7V0Qc1Yt/B8VGVk=; b=TiIR+sSErMM+E6fTJ9pwOXt6Vei+NYsqlOKDuahOE49zPm/i50CeykBeqy92sRQ9XxBxhP NMYUUPgfqkEFsjKEuvAOjOmo/2QPs/Qp8cJrW0oq4tiu/Yl3c2/G8EkYRQgHZh7LzSWvUT iAJ9T4qYz6cyDIq0Vc+qxf9oHJM72Q6fST398zdZ/qLNBVJCR7O1Br5DRwuiEF2ndY/RuS IWC1Bw3jgK+2Lez72WTU0bitOOVu4Z8d/S0Zlfyda69YroBjzab3CimnBWDg+Viakxbboy MWAZN9a+Ik/YyFHAzPewoj74x16SBBZzFHgL5KiswhJXTwKXnC6TpvuZoT+QeQ== Received: from kenobi.freebsd.org (kenobi.freebsd.org [IPv6:2610:1c1:1:606c::50:1d]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4RnJ126Dx3zTsN for ; Fri, 15 Sep 2023 15:25:42 +0000 (UTC) (envelope-from bugzilla-noreply@freebsd.org) Received: from kenobi.freebsd.org ([127.0.1.5]) by kenobi.freebsd.org (8.15.2/8.15.2) with ESMTP id 38FFPgC5020153 for ; Fri, 15 Sep 2023 15:25:42 GMT (envelope-from bugzilla-noreply@freebsd.org) Received: (from www@localhost) by kenobi.freebsd.org (8.15.2/8.15.2/Submit) id 38FFPgZT020151 for standards@FreeBSD.org; Fri, 15 Sep 2023 15:25:42 GMT (envelope-from bugzilla-noreply@freebsd.org) X-Authentication-Warning: kenobi.freebsd.org: www set sender to bugzilla-noreply@freebsd.org using -f From: bugzilla-noreply@freebsd.org To: standards@FreeBSD.org Subject: [Bug 273712] off64_t namespace pollution in or incomplete LFS64 API support Date: Fri, 15 Sep 2023 15:25:42 +0000 X-Bugzilla-Reason: AssignedTo X-Bugzilla-Type: changed X-Bugzilla-Watch-Reason: None X-Bugzilla-Product: Base System X-Bugzilla-Component: standards X-Bugzilla-Version: CURRENT X-Bugzilla-Keywords: X-Bugzilla-Severity: Affects Only Me X-Bugzilla-Who: imp@FreeBSD.org X-Bugzilla-Status: Open X-Bugzilla-Resolution: X-Bugzilla-Priority: --- X-Bugzilla-Assigned-To: standards@FreeBSD.org X-Bugzilla-Flags: X-Bugzilla-Changed-Fields: cc Message-ID: In-Reply-To: References: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-Bugzilla-URL: https://bugs.freebsd.org/bugzilla/ Auto-Submitted: auto-generated List-Id: Standards compliance List-Archive: https://lists.freebsd.org/archives/freebsd-standards List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-freebsd-standards@freebsd.org X-BeenThere: freebsd-standards@freebsd.org MIME-Version: 1.0 https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=3D273712 Warner Losh changed: What |Removed |Added ---------------------------------------------------------------------------- CC| |imp@FreeBSD.org --- Comment #3 from Warner Losh --- FreeBSD's headers have a dichotomy between the _foo_SOURCE macro defined and what's visible by checking _foo_VISIBLE. We should maintain that here. However, FreeBSD doesn't implement the full range of these functions. It was dubious at best that they were ever defined in the first place. And we'd ne= ed to make a number of other changes before this would be safe. So it's not quite so simple to provide the interface. --=20 You are receiving this mail because: You are the assignee for the bug.=